Code P0ACC 2017 Chevrolet Silverado Description

Hybrid/EV Battery Temperature Sensors are used to monitor the battery temperature. The non-serviceable battery temperature sensors are located within the battery sections. Two temperature sensors are located in each battery section. The temperature sensor is a variable resistor that measures the temperature of the battery cell group. The hybrid/EV interface control module supplies 5 V to the signal circuit and is a ground for the low reference circuit. The battery temperature sensor resistance changes with battery temperature. As the temperature decreases, the sensor resistance increases. As the temperature increases, the sensor resistance decreases.
Each Hybrid/EV Battery Interface Control Module communicates the temperature sensor values to the Hybrid/EV Powertrain Control Module via serial data.
The Hybrid/EV Powertrain Control Module uses the battery temperature sensors to determine the Hybrid/EV Battery Module temperature in order to control the battery cooling system operation.
The Diagnostic Trouble Code (DTC) will be set when the hybrid battery temperature sensor is greater than 160°C (320°F).

What are the Possible Causes of the DTC P0ACC 2017 Chevrolet Silverado?

  • Faulty Hybrid/EV Battery Assembly
  • Hybrid/EV Battery Assembly harness is open or shorted
  • Hybrid/EV Battery Assembly circuit poor electrical connection
  • Faulty Hybrid/EV Battery Interface Control Module

How to Fix the DTC P0ACC 2017 Chevrolet Silverado?

Review the 'Possible Causes' above and visually examine the corresponding wiring harness and connectors. Check for damaged components and inspect connector pins for signs of being broken, bent, pushed out, or corroded.

What is the Cost to Diagnose the Code?

Labor: 1.0

To diagnose the P0ACC 2017 Chevrolet Silverado code, it typically requires 1.0 hour of labor. Rates vary by location, vehicle, and shop. Many shops charge between $80–$150 per hour; dealerships and metro areas may be higher, independents may be lower.
